WebOct 1, 2014 · (1) sin ( 2 θ) = 2 sin ( θ) cos ( θ) that you can use in your problem. If you know that sin ( θ) = x 3, all you need to do to find sin ( 2 θ) is to find cos ( θ) and then use the Identity (1). WebTo solve a trigonometric simplify the equation using trigonometric identities. Then, write the equation in a standard form, and isolate the variable using algebraic manipulation to solve for the variable. Use inverse trigonometric functions to find the solutions, and check for extraneous solutions. What is a basic trigonometric equation?
